在我们的日常生活和工作中,经常需要将PDF文件转换成图像,方便我们进行使用和分享。如果你正在寻找一种简单但可靠的方法转换PDF为图像,那么你就来对地方了。这篇文章将向你展示如何使用Ghostscript将PDF文件转换为高质量图像,在Windows、Mac OS X和Linux等平台上都可以使用。
首先,如果你还不熟悉Ghostscript,那么我们先来介绍一下它。Ghostscript是一种用于渲染PDF和PostScript文件的开源软件。它可以在各种操作系统上使用,并提供了许多选项和命令行参数来满足各种转换需求。Ghostscript能够将PDF文件转换为许多种格式的图像,包括PNG、JPEG、TIFF、GIF和BMP等。
好的,接下来是步骤:
1. 安装Ghostscript
在你进行任何操作之前,需要先下载并安装Ghostscript。Ghostscript可以通过其官方网站进行下载。打开Ghostscript官网后,首先选择适合你操作系统的版本,选择后会出现下载文件,直接点击下载即可。
2. 转换命令
在你安装好Ghostscript后,你就可以使用以下命令将PDF转换为图像:
```
gs -dSAFER -dBATCH -dNOPAUSE -sDEVICE=jpeg -dJPEGQ=100 -r300 -sOutputFile=output.jpg input.pdf
```
在上述代码中,需要替换"output.jpg"为你所想要的输出图像文件名,同时替换"input.pdf"为你需要转换的PDF文件名。如果你的PDF文件不在当前目录中,那么就需要提供PDF文件的完整路径。
命令中各参数的含义:
- -dSAFER:强制Ghostscript在输出任何文件之前执行一些安全性检查。
- -dBATCH:告诉Ghostscript在处理文件后退出。
- -dNOPAUSE:禁止Ghostscript在输出每个页面之前暂停。
- -sDEVICE:告诉Ghostscript可以将PDF文件转化为哪种格式的图像。在这个例子中,我们选择了JPEG格式。
- -dJPEGQ=100:设置JPEG格式的输出质量,这里我们将它设置为100%。
- -r300:设置图像的分辨率,以PPI(每英寸像素数)为单位。这里我们将它设置为300 PPI。
3. 转换PDF文件
在你输入了上述命令之后,会开始对PDF文件进行转换。Ghostscript会按照参数指定的格式将PDF文件转换为图像,并将它保存成输出文件。这个转换过程可能需要一些时间,因为它需要处理整个PDF文件的内容。
4. 转换完成
转换完成后,可以在指定的输出文件目录中找到生成的图像文件。上述命令会将PDF文件转换为单个JPEG格式的图像,如果你想生成其他格式的图像,只需要简单更改命令中的-sDEVICE参数即可。
总结
使用Ghostscript将PDF转换为图像是一种灵活简单的方式,它可以在各种操作系统下使用并且可以输出许多不同的格式。本文介绍了如何使用Ghostscript将PDF转换为高质量图像的步骤,也给出了转换命令以供参考。在将来的工作中,无论是在Windows、Mac OS X还是Linux系统中,如果你需要将PDF文件转换为图像,只要掌握了这个方法,你就可以轻松地实现。